这使得显示的信息更加详细,并可以更准确地了解网站无法访问的原因。可以为任何 CMS 启用调试:
乔姆拉
– 配置.php;
OpenCart – Environment.php 和 t.d.
检查PHP版本的兼容性
如果网站和服务器上使用不同的 PHP 版本,则可能会导致冲突,并且资源将根本无法加载。在这种情况下,这将直接在错误描述中报告。例如:
扩展“mysql”自 PHP 5.5 起已弃用,自 PHP 7.0 起已删除;使用 mysqli 代替
复制
此错误意味着用户尝试使用 PHP 7.0 版本运行网站,即使它已适应较早的 PHP 版本。在这种情况下,需要更新网站和服务器上的 PHP 版本,以便它们匹配。
使用Strace
这是一个高级实用程序,允许您诊断和修复运行Linux 的服务器上发生的几乎所有错误。通过 SSH 连接到服务器,然后安装 strace:
须藤apt更新
sudo apt 安装 strace
复制
这些命令适用于 Ubuntu,但将命令改编为其他操作系统并不困难。фIDS 和 IPS 都是用于正确监控潜在威胁的系统。这些入侵系统本质上是不同的,我们将深入研究不同的控制和监视方法。如果这个主题听起来很有趣,请继续阅读以获取您需要的所有信息。
什么是入侵检测系统(IDS)?
IDS 或入侵检测系统通常是指负责监控系统或网络上的在线威胁的软件应用程序或设备。有关可疑活动的信息通常会报告给管理员或通过 SIEM 系统收集。
就 IDS 的工作方式而言,存在三种可能的方法:
异常检测。 IDS可用于监视计算机和网络活动并将其分为正常活动和异常活动。此类系统最初旨在检测可疑活动。该方法主要基于机器学习的使用,其中学习正确的行为模式并将其与新的或不寻常的行为模式进行比较。该方法由于其通用特性而更具优势,但可能会导致误报问题
基于签名的检测。这种方法被认为更传统,基于寻找称为签名的特定模式。此类检测有助于识别已知的网络攻击,但难以识别新的威胁模式
基于声誉的检测。这里声誉值影响整个过程。
现在您已经了解了 IDS 的工作原理,接下来我们来谈谈该系统的主要类型。主要分类包括两类:
NIDS。这种类型的 IDS 监视传入流量。系统分析流入/流出设备的流量活动。所有活动都会根据现有的可能攻击库进行检查,一旦检测到任何可疑内容,管理员就会收到警报
HIDS。这样的系统对于正确监控设备或单个主机上的操作系统是必要的。所有数据包均受到监控以检测异常活动。当系统中的关键文件被修改时,会发出警告。
什么是入侵防御系统 (IPS)
IPS 或入侵防御系统的工作原理是检测威胁活动、报告此类活动并尝试阻止这些威胁。通常,IPS 直接位于防火墙后面。该系统对于识别与安全策略相关的问题、检测网络犯罪分子和检测文档威胁非常有用。
通过修改攻击内容、重新配置防火墙或其他方法来防止 IPS 中的威胁活动。一些用户认为IPS是IDS的延伸,主要是因为两个系统都负责监控网络。
以下是解释 IPS 工作原理的一些方法:
监控状态日志分析:此 IPS 方法将所有活动与一般规则进行比较,以检测偏差
基于签名的监控:通过这种方法,IPS 检测网络数据包,然后将它们与标准模式(签名)进行比较
基于统计异常的监控:此方法检查网络活动并将其与预定义的基线进行比较。该基线确定了被视为正常的基本特征,例如: B. 使用某些协议或使用的带宽。如果基本配置出现问题,可能会导致误报。
一旦检测到可疑活动,IPS 可以通过以下方式做出响应:
阻止通过某些模式违反安全规则的用户,并阻止访问网络、主机或应用程序
终止 TCP 会话以响应可疑活动
网络攻击后删除威胁内容或删除受感染的数据
重新配置防火墙以防止在不久的将来出现类似的攻击。
IPS类型的分类包括:
WIPS。这种类型的 IPS 会检测未经授权的访问,并在检测到后立即将其删除。 WIPS 通常作为无线 LAN 基础设施的覆盖层工作,但也可以独立使用。 WIPS 可用于防止蜜罐、恶意接入点、拒绝服务攻击、 伊朗手机号码数据库
MAC 欺骗等风险。
臀部。这些系统分析主机上代码的行为以检测异常活动。 HIPS 对于保护敏感信息免遭未经授权的访问特别有用。
国家信息处理计划。检测是通过分析网络上的数据包来完成的。安装后,将立即收集有关主机和网络的数据。通过拒绝数据包、限制带宽和限制 TCP 连接来实现防御攻击
NBA此分析基于网络上的正常和异常行为。为了确定什么是正常的,系统首先需要一段学习时间来识别模式和偏差。
strace的语法如下:
strac
复制
这里我们有:
strace -s999 – 调用带有详细输出的 strace 命令并将其写
/opt/php71/php – PHP 解释器地址;
index.php – 要访问的文件的路径。
该实用程序允许您监视所有代表形成进程和操作系统内核之间接口的转换机制的系统调用。您可以拦截并读取所有呼叫,只需一点技巧和知识即可诊断并修复任何错误。
结论
我们希望本文可以帮助您了解网站关闭的原因以及您可以采取哪些措施。如果您有任何疑问,请随时通过实时聊天联系我们的团队。祝你今天过得愉快!